## Broker Upgrade Notes — Contractor Onboarding

We're migrating the Quillbus message broker from v4 to v5 across the Marrowgate environment. Upgrades are rolled node-by-node; drain each node before patching and confirm queue depth returns to baseline. The upgrade bundle must verify against our signing key before installation, so import the key below into your trust store first.

deploy key for yajop-fahop: bky3_h1v

Subject: DR drill results — DeployDot chat bot failover

Hi support team,

Yesterday's disaster-recovery drill for DeployDot, our chat bot that answers deploy-status queries, went smoothly overall. Failover to the Harrowmere standby took four minutes; status replies resumed automatically. One gap: the bot's credential store did not re-sync, so we restored it manually from the recovery vault. For future drills, you'll need to unlock that vault yourselves, using the passphrase written directly below.

unlock words, bahop-fawef: novmir-druwyn-soriel-rusdor-kasion

## Quartzline Environments

Welcome aboard! Quartzline runs three environments: dev, staging, and prod. Your contractor role grants read access everywhere but write access only in dev. Staging writes need a request to the platform leads, and prod is locked to the release crew — don't take it personally, everyone starts here. If you hit a 403, check which environment your token targets before pinging anyone. For local setup, the staging values below are the ones you want.

service settings:
PRAIX_LOG_LEVEL=error
PRAIX_METRICS_HOST=metrics.praix.qorvelcorp.corp
PRAIX_POOL_SIZE=16

The Pellwick Relay service emits high-volume logs, so the /v2/log-sample endpoint applies a configurable sampling rate before forwarding entries to the support console. Support staff should request a rate no higher than 0.25 during incident review to avoid flooding downstream parsers. Each sampling request must be authenticated; include the following bearer token in the Authorization header.

portal login ticket: eyJhbGciOiJIUzI1NiIsInR5cCI6IkpXVCJ9.eyJzdWIiOiIMjvRAf3PEFIn0.nuv9gjixLtnr